SUBJECT / RECOMMENDATIONS

Approve Grant Application to the Florida Department of Education, and if Approved, Accept Funds for the Florida Inclusion Network, 2008/2009 - $212,000 (Exceptional Student Education)

EXECUTIVE SUMMARY

We request approval to submit a grant application for Florida Inclusion Network (FIN) to continue to provide direct services to all schools, school staff, families, and agencies to ensure that educational services are inclusive to all students. The major goals for 2008/2009 include increases for students with disabilities in learning gains in reading and math within the least restrictive environment, and increases in family centered activities sponsored by FIN.

FIN collaborates with various district instructional divisions in providing district and school-based workshops and learning opportunities for all teachers, both ESE and General Education, in meeting the needs of diverse learners in the general education classroom; school-based technical assistance and follow-up; problem solving planning sessions; individual collaborative team planning for students with disabilities; and sharing of current research information and resources resulting in the inclusion of all students and increased student outcomes. ANNUAL DISTRICT GOAL(S) AND CRITICAL SUCCESS FACTOR(S)

Goal 5 - The district will eliminate the FCAT achievement gap by a minimum of 10 percentage points as reported by No Child Left Behind.

FINANCIAL IMPACT (Budgeted: Yes)

If approved, grant funds of $212,000 will be included in the divisional special revenue/federal programs budget.

EVALUATION

Performance evaluation measures are determined by the Florida Department of Education. The completed annual state performance report will be available in December 2009. The results of the evaluation will be shared with all stakeholders.
